These ESL grammar activities give your beginner level English Language Learners or Newcomer ELLs multiple opportunities to learn and retain the English Verb To Be in conjunction with contractions. Students use the study guides with picture support as they work through the material.

As an ESL teacher of older students (MS & HS), I was disappointed with material available for older learners, so I decided to create my own. There is nothing more embarrassing for a teen to be seen working on material depicting little kids and baby animals. The graphics in my units encompass multicultural Older Elementary, MS, HS, and Adults in various settings.
The units are designed to provide scaffolded support as students work with the material. There are multiple opportunities for optimal retention.
Each new skill is introduced with a student study guide/chart. My students keep these charts handy and use them as reference tools as they work through the material.
Each new skill also comes with plenty of activities. These activities allow students to apply the new skill in multiple contexts.
